How To Unpack Enigma Protector Top (2024)
Unpacking Enigma Protector is a multi-layered process that involves bypassing advanced security features like virtual machines (VM), Import Address Table (IAT) obfuscation, and anti-debugging tricks. While newer versions (7.x and above) are significantly more complex, many older and mid-range versions can still be unpacked using specialized scripts and manual debugging techniques. 1. Identify the Enigma Version
Recommendations & next steps
- Document each breakpoint and patch applied for reproducibility.
- Automate repeated steps with scripts (Frida, Python+pefile).
- For complex protections, consider collaborating with experienced reverse engineers or using commercial unpacking services.
To bypass:
Strategy B – Trace API calls with API Monitor
Run the original protected EXE under API Monitor, filter kernel32!LoadLibraryA/W and GetProcAddress. Log all loaded DLLs and APIs. Then manually add these to Scylla. how to unpack enigma protector top
. Finally, optimize the file size to ensure it runs correctly as a standalone executable. Specialized Unpacking Tools If the file was protected using Enigma Virtual Box Unpacking Enigma Protector is a multi-layered process that
Step 1: Initial Reconnaissance – Identifying Enigma Protector
Run detect it easy (DIE) or PEiD with advanced signatures on the target executable. Enigma typically shows: To bypass: Strategy B – Trace API calls